Nephrons are the “functional units” of the kidney; they cleanse the blood of toxins and balance the constituents of the circulation to homeostatic set points through the processes of filtration, reabsorption, and secretion

Renal cortex. 0.5 µm thick section of material embedded in plastic, stained with toluidine blue. Three kidney renal corpuscles are observed, separated by proximal and distal convoluted tubules, sectioned in different planes. In the two superior renal corpuscles, the sectional plane affected the macula densa of the juxtaglomerular apparatus.

Micrograph of Renal Cell Carcinoma (RCC). Renal cell carcinoma is a kidney cancer that originates in the lining of the proximal convoluted tubule, a part of the very small tubes in the kidney that transport waste molecules from the blood to the urine. RCC is the most common type of kidney cancer in adults, responsible for approximately 90–95% of cases. Initial treatment is most commonly either partial or complete removal of the affected kidney(s). Where the cancer has not metastasised (spread to other organs) or burrowed deeper into the tissues of the kidney, the 5-year survival rate is 65–90%, but this is lowered considerably when the cancer has spread.

Renin-angiotensin-aldosterone system it is physiological system that regulates blood pressure in response to changes in blood volume. Renin is a hormone produced by the kidneys. Aldosterone is a steroid hormone produced by adrenal gland. Angiotensinogen is an globulin synthesized in the liver. Angiotensin-converting enzyme (ACE) at the lungs.

The kidneys are two bean-shaped organs found in vertebrates. They are located on the left and right in the retro peritoneal space, and in adult humans are about centimeters in length. They receive blood from the paired renal arteries; blood exits into the paired renal veins. Each kidney is attached to a ureter, a tube that carries excreted urine to the bladder.
